Troubleshooting Mysterious Network Disconnects: Identifying and Resolving the Root Causes
Understanding Network Connectivity Challenges
As an experienced IT professional, I’ve encountered numerous cases where users struggle with unexpected network disconnects, causing frustration and disrupting productivity. These mysterious issues can stem from a variety of sources, ranging from hardware and software incompatibilities to network configuration problems. In this comprehensive guide, we’ll explore the common causes of network disconnects and provide practical, step-by-step troubleshooting strategies to help you identify and resolve the root issues.
Examining the Impact of Enhanced Security Measures
One potential factor contributing to network disconnects is the implementation of enhanced security measures. As organizations strive to protect their networks, they may introduce temporary or permanent security protocols that can inadvertently disrupt user connectivity. For example, a user experiencing random GlobalProtect disconnects on their home computer could be the result of additional security measures in place on the corporate Palo Alto firewall.
When investigating these types of issues, it’s essential to review the relevant logs, such as the PanGPS log on the local device and the system logs on the Palo Alto firewall. These logs can provide valuable clues about the nature of the disconnect, whether it’s a client-side problem or an issue with the firewall configuration.
Identifying Hardware and Firmware Compatibility Challenges
Another common cause of network disconnects is incompatibility between hardware components and their associated firmware or drivers. This is particularly prevalent in enterprise environments with a mix of different server and network adapter models.
For instance, users with HP ProLiant BL460c Gen9 servers equipped with HP FlexFabric 20Gb 2-port 650FLB adapters have reported intermittent VM connectivity issues. These problems have been linked to specific firmware and driver combinations, where certain versions can cause VMs to lose network connectivity at random intervals.
To address these challenges, it’s crucial to ensure that all hardware components, including network adapters, are running the latest, compatible firmware and driver versions. In some cases, downgrading to a previous, stable firmware or driver release may be necessary to resolve the issue.
Exploring Network Configuration Anomalies
Network configuration issues can also contribute to mysterious network disconnects. Factors such as VLAN availability, port-channel settings, and switch MAC address table behavior can all play a role in causing these problems.
In one reported case, users with VMware environments running on HP C7000 enclosures experienced intermittent VM network connectivity issues. The root cause was traced back to a combination of factors, including Virtual Connect firmware versions, network adapter firmware, and potential MAC address table issues on the physical switches.
To troubleshoot these types of problems, it’s essential to thoroughly examine the network infrastructure, from the virtual distributed switches in the VMware environment to the physical switches and routers. Ensuring consistent VLAN configurations, monitoring for MAC address table anomalies, and validating the firmware versions of all network components can help identify and resolve the underlying connectivity problems.
Implementing a Structured Troubleshooting Approach
When faced with network disconnect issues, it’s crucial to follow a structured troubleshooting approach to efficiently identify and address the root causes. Here’s a step-by-step guide to help you navigate the process:
Step 1: Gather Relevant Information
Start by collecting as much information as possible about the network disconnect incidents. This includes:
* Detailed descriptions of the problem, including the frequency, duration, and impact on user productivity
* Relevant event logs, such as those from the operating system, network adapters, and any centralized logging systems
* Configuration details of the affected devices, including network adapter firmware and driver versions, network settings, and any recent changes
Compiling this information will provide a solid foundation for your troubleshooting efforts and help you identify potential patterns or common factors across the affected devices.
Step 2: Isolate the Problem
Once you have the necessary information, the next step is to isolate the problem and determine whether it’s a client-side, network, or server-related issue. This can be achieved by:
* Performing connectivity tests, such as pinging known-good destinations or testing remote desktop connections
* Comparing the behavior of affected devices with those that are functioning correctly
* Checking for any common factors or differences between the affected and unaffected devices, such as network adapter models, firmware versions, or configuration settings
By isolating the problem, you can better understand the scope and nature of the issue, which will guide your subsequent troubleshooting steps.
Step 3: Analyze the Network Environment
If the problem appears to be network-related, conduct a comprehensive analysis of the network infrastructure. This may include:
* Reviewing VLAN configurations and ensuring consistent settings across all network devices
* Checking for any changes or updates to network equipment, such as switches, routers, or Virtual Connect modules
* Monitoring the behavior of the network, including MAC address table activity, port-channel status, and any indications of network congestion or errors
Pay close attention to any potential points of failure or areas where the network configuration may be contributing to the connectivity issues.
Step 4: Investigate Hardware and Firmware Compatibility
If the problem is isolated to specific devices or network adapters, delve deeper into the hardware and firmware compatibility aspects. This may involve:
* Verifying that the network adapters are running the latest, compatible firmware and drivers
* Exploring any known issues or compatibility problems associated with the hardware components
* Considering the option to downgrade to a previous, stable firmware version if the current one is causing problems
By ensuring that all hardware components are running compatible firmware and drivers, you can eliminate potential sources of incompatibility that may be contributing to the network disconnect incidents.
Step 5: Implement and Test Solutions
Based on your findings, implement the appropriate solutions to address the root causes of the network disconnect issues. This may include:
* Updating network adapter firmware and drivers to the recommended versions
* Modifying network configurations, such as VLAN settings or port-channel configurations
* Applying any necessary patches or updates to network equipment, such as switches or Virtual Connect modules
After implementing the solutions, thoroughly test the network connectivity to verify that the problems have been resolved. Monitor the environment for a suitable period to ensure the stability and reliability of the network.
Staying Vigilant and Proactive
Troubleshooting network disconnect issues requires a combination of technical expertise, attention to detail, and a proactive approach. By following the structured troubleshooting steps outlined in this guide, you can effectively identify and resolve the root causes of these mysterious network connectivity problems.
Remember, staying up-to-date with the latest hardware and software versions, closely monitoring the network environment, and being vigilant about any configuration changes can go a long way in preventing and mitigating future network disconnect incidents. By taking a proactive stance, you can ensure a stable and reliable network environment for your organization, ultimately enhancing user productivity and satisfaction.
For more information and IT solutions, please visit our website at https://itfix.org.uk/.